The Importance of Waupan with Rohn Bishop
16 JUN. 2024 · In the wake of the charges against the warden and 8 others at the Waupan Correction Institution related to prisoner deaths, Robin talks with Waupan Mayor Rohn Bishop about the history of the town, the prison, and his concerns over the charges and the prison's future. -
New Charges in Electors Conspiracy Case
9 JUN. 2024 · Robin talks with Forum regular Charles Franklin, director of the Marquette Law School Poll, about the recent criminal complaint filing by AG Josh Kaul against three men regarding the alleged unappointed electors conspiracy in 2020. -
Serving with the Army National Guard
26 MAY. 2024 · Robin sits down with Staff Sergeant Derek Ruck to talk about his experience as part of the Army National Guard. -
Bailing Out Benji
12 MAY. 2024 · In the wake of several Wisconsin dog breeders appearing on the Humane Society of the United State's Horrible Hundred List, Robin talks with Alexis Bell, Research Analyst at Bailing out Benji, an Iowa-based nonprofit organization dedicated to ending puppy mill cruelty. -
The Importance of Immunizations with Dr. Stephanie Schauer
5 MAY. 2024 · Robin talks with Dr. Stephanie Schauer, Immunization Program Manager with Wisconsin's Department of Health, about measles, it's resurgence, and what can be done about it. The also cover whooping coughing, rubella, and other infectious (but preventable) diseases. -
April Is Library Month!
28 ABR. 2024 · With School Library Month, National Library Week, and National Librarian Day all being in April, Robin sits down with Liz Boyd, marketing specialist for Madison Public Library, to talk about all that the city libraries have to offer. -
Big Mac Guy: An Interview with Don Gorske
14 ABR. 2024 · Robin talks with Don Gorske, also known as the Big Mac Guy - the man who hold the Guinness World Record for Most McDonald's Big Macs eaten - about his life, work, and love of Big Macs. -
Lake Monona Waterfront Plan with Landscape Architect Mike Sturm
7 ABR. 2024 · Robin talks with Mike Sturm, landscape architect with the City of Madison Parks Department, about the Lake Monona Waterfront Plan. -
Study and Survival: Colorectal Cancer Awareness with Dr. Dustin Deming
24 MAR. 2024 · March is Colorectal Cancer Awareness Month, so Robin talks with Dr. Dustin Deming, a medical oncologist and laboratory researcher at UW Health's Carbone Cancer Center, whose focus on gastrointestinal cancers became intensely personal after he was diagnosed with colorectal cancer himself. -
The Dangers of Wildfires with Amy Penn
10 MAR. 2024 · Robin talks with Amy Penn, a forestry specialist with the Wisconsin Department of Natural Resources, about the current danger of wildfires and what we may be seeing this season.
